      Start a routine that inspires them for life: This month is National Reading Month and schools and parents across the country are getting involved in promoting a love of reading in children.  I love reading to my daughter and continue to do so even though she can read early chapter books.  It is more than reading to her, we enjoy this downtime and pick out books to read together. Young children who read 20 minutes per day scored above the 90th percentile on standardized reading tests.* Take the challenge to read to your child each day, and create a love of reading to last a lifetime.         Leap Frog has been the go-to company for many parents because their educational toys and games are really well made and designed.  My daughter learned how to read with their LeapReader and we have used their games on several occasions.  Recently, LeapFrog has leaped into gaming with their new LeapTV that teaches core skills across a variety of subjects including: reading, mathematics, science and problem solving. Designed for kids ages 3-8, the system uses a motion-sensing camera and controller that fits small hands.
